An oak aged Pinot Gris that would put a smile on any Chardonnay drinkers face. The nose has a lot of mealy and toast aromas with some dried apricot and minerals. The palate is ripe and round but has a steely focus from the mineral laden fruit. Almost traces of Chablis like wet stones are evident and the oak strings out the impressive length.
